  • A first conviction for driving while intoxicated (DWI) or driving while ability impaired by drugs (DWAI-Drugs) carries a six-month license suspension and possible jail time. New York law also requires an ignition interlock on a first offense.
  • A blood alcohol content (BAC) of .18 (aggravated DWI) increases the penalties.
  • Refusing the Breathalyzer results in automatic license suspension for one year, with no conditional license.
  • Commercial drivers (CDL) are considered in violation at .04 BAC.
  • Drivers under age 21 are considered in violation at .02 BAC.
  • A second DWI conviction is punishable by up to four years in state prison.
  • A third DWI offense carries mandatory prison time and possible permanent driver's license revocation.
